GlennR Posted June 1, 2014 Share Posted June 1, 2014 Juices are very much discouraged during a Whole30 except as ingredients in a recipe. Among other things, the program is about setting good eating habits and digestive/hormonal rhythms, and drinking your nutrients is not a good way to do this.
